You might say that this … WebJan 17, 2024 · scape ( plural scapes ) ( botany) A leafless stalk growing directly out of a root. The basal segment of an insect 's antenna (i.e. the part closest to the body). The basal part of the ovipositor of an insect, more specifically known as the oviscape. ( architecture) The shaft of a column. ( architecture) The apophyge of a shaft. WebNov 28, 2016 · -scape is not a native English suffix. It arises by extension from the term landscape, meaning a painting of a rural or remote area; this was taken into English in the 17th century from Dutch landschap, at a period when the Netherlands were perhaps the major center of artistic innovation in Europe.. WebJul 22, 2024 · 13.2: The Five "Scapes" of Globalization. As we have already established, globalization refers to the increasing pace and scope of interconnections crisscrossing the globe. Anthropologist Arjun Appadurai has discussed this in terms of five specific “scapes” or flows: ethnoscapes, technoscapes, ideoscapes, financescapes, and mediascapes. Webscapegoat, Hebrew saʿir la-ʿAzaʾzel, (“goat for Azazel”), in the Yom Kippur ritual described in the Torah (Leviticus 16:8–10), goat ritually burdened with the sins of the Jewish people. The scapegoat was sent into the wilderness for Azazel, possibly for the purpose of placating that evil spirit, while a separate goat was slain as an offering to God. A peduncle rising from the ground or from a subterranean stem, as in the stemless violets, the bloodroot, … WebMar 22, 2024 · The word “soundscape” is made of two parts: “sound” and “scape.” All sounds are vibrations. These vibrations travel to our inner ear, where they are turned into electrical signals, and then sent to the brain for interpretation. The suffix -scape means scene, picture or view. We all know this suffix from the word “landscape.”

WebScapegoating is a hostile tactic often employed to characterize an entire group of individuals according to the unethical or immoral conduct of a small number of individuals belonging to that group. Scapegoating relates to guilt by association and stereotyping. Scapegoated groups throughout history have included almost every imaginable group of ...
